Stock-to-Flow Model
The Stock-to-Flow (S2F) model for Bitcoin was proposed by the pseudonymous analyst known as PlanB. This model was first introduced in March 2019. PlanB defines Bitcoin as a digital asset based on a peer-to-peer (P2P) network, cryptographic algorithms, and proof-of-work, possessing scarcity. The Stock-to-Flow model is a valuation model that quantifies scarcity to estimate future prices. Typically, the higher the Stock-to-Flow ratio, the higher the asset's valuation.
Up to $135,000 in December
PlanB revisited his June tweets on Twitter, boasting that his August prediction was on target:
Bitcoin was below $34,000 due to FUD surrounding Musk's energy narrative, China's crackdown on mining, and fundamentally, the market weakness seen in July and August. My worst predictions for the year: August > $47K, September > $43K, October > $63K, November > $98K, December > $135K.
✅ Aug > $47K https://t.co/tj6SSwSzKR
— PlanB (@100trillionUSD) August 13, 2021
While Bitcoin has generally followed the Stock-to-Flow model trend upwards, the volatility remains significant, with price model upper and lower limits being very wide. Therefore, figures like Ethereum co-founder Vitalik Buterin and Bridgewater Associates founder Ray Dalio have publicly stated that the Stock-to-Flow model is not realistic.
